1Vision Biogas is set to become a leading biogas player in the Nordics

Share

1Vision Biogas AB announces the closing of the acquisition of St1 Nordic Oy’s biogas assets. 1Vision Biogas is a joint venture between St1, HitecVision and Aneo. 1Vision Biogas acquired earlier this year 100% ownership of Biokraft International AB, the leading producer of liquified biogas in the Nordic region. 1Vision Biogas integrates the two entities into one company with the ambition of becoming the leading biogas company in the Nordics, operating the entire biogas value chain from feedstock sourcing all the way to sales and distribution.

1Vision Biogas sees liquified biogas as a key growth opportunity within the energy transition. The growth company is aiming for 3 TWh biomethane production and 6 TWh biomethane sales by 2030, targeting heavy transportation, maritime and industrial applications. To achieve its goals, 1Vision Biogas is committed to investing more than EUR 1 billion in biogas production and distribution networks in the Nordic countries. With these acquisitions, the current production capacity of 1Vision Biogas is over 550 GWh and the combined sales of biomethane are approximately 1 TWh. In addition, there are several biogas growth projects in Sweden, Norway and Finland.

1Vision Biogas builds on strong expertise in energy transition

St1, HitecVision and Aneo joined forces in December last year with the aim of creating a leading biogas platform in the Nordics. The new Nordic biogas company consists of entities with complementary set-ups and builds on strong industrial logic capabilities. 1Vision Biogas will operate an end-to-end biogas value chain, from feedstock sourcing all the way to sales and distribution. St1's strong sales organization and network will continue the distribution of 1Vision Biogas’ products.  

Biokraft has a strong upstream asset base with five biogas production and upgrading plants in Sweden and Norway and a logistics company. St1 has seven biogas production and upgrading units in Sweden, a network of compressed and liquified biogas stations together with bus depot refuelling points. In Sweden, St1 is already a leading biogas provider for the traffic segment. This acquisition announcement has no impact on the growth projects that both Biokraft and St1 are running in the Nordics.

HitecVision manages energy-focused private equity funds with a total committed capital base of EUR 8 billion, and it has an extensive track-record in developing energy companies in Europe. All new investment platforms from HitecVision’s funds will contribute to the energy transition.

Aneo is a Nordic renewable energy company that invests in renewable energy production, electrification, and energy efficiency, with roots in renewable energy production that span over 70 years.

Biogas technology is an existing solution to substantial emissions reductions

“Biogas is an important part of society’s energy transition. It is a concrete renewable energy solution with available technology, scalable production and competitive product. Liquified biogas production is a great example of the circular economy resulting in significant greenhouse gas emissions reductions in traffic, especially for heavy-duty transport. For example, manure as feedstock reduces not only emissions in transport but also agricultural emissions and the emissions reduction can even be higher than 100%,” says Miika Johansson.

In the future, there is also potential for recovery, storage and utilization of bio-CO2. The biogas business contributes to developing a Nordic energy system taking steps towards the EU climate targets.

Biokraft is a Nordic greentech company that produces bioenergy and plant nutrition in a circular cycle by recycling organic waste and residual products in large-scale biorefineries. Biogas is CO2-neutral and lowers GHG emissions by over 100% when replacing fossil fuels. Biokraft will build, own and operate large-scale biogas plants with a focus on the Northern European market. Today, there are facilities in Sweden, Norway and Korea. Biokraft has 130 employees and had total revenues of SEK 534 million in 2023. www.biokraft.com
